One of the projects we enjoyed doing while he was here was cleaning in Pacca. Once a month on a Wednesday evening, we have a work project at someone’s place. That time was Esmeralda’s turn.

At the time, she was tasked with cleaning the plaza in her village. Each person has to accept work in the village, or they are heavily fined. It worked perfectly for the church to come that Wednesday evening and help her knock that project out.

Esmeralda then served us supper. We had all worked hard and fast, so we were tired. But I think Nathan may have been more beat than some from running the weed eater.
